How to Grow Knautia in the United States: Balcony & Indoor Setup – Complete How-To

Knautia, also known as the Pincushion Flower, is a beautiful and unique perennial plant that can be a wonderful addition to any garden or indoor space. Native to parts of Europe and Asia, Knautia has become popular in the United States for its vibrant, globe-shaped flowers and its ability to thrive in a variety of growing conditions. Whether you have a sprawling backyard or a small balcony, Knautia can be a low-maintenance and eye-catching plant that contributes to the overall health and beauty of your space.

Outdoor Cultivation: Growing Knautia in Your Garden

Knautia is a hardy perennial that can tolerate a wide range of growing conditions, making it an excellent choice for gardens across the United States. Here’s what you need to know to get started:

Selecting the Right Variety

When it comes to Knautia, there are several species and cultivars to choose from, each with its own unique characteristics. Some of the most popular varieties for gardeners in the US include:

  • Knautia macedonica: This species is known for its large, vibrant purple-red flowers and its ability to thrive in full sun.
  • Knautia arvensis: Also called the Field Scabious, this variety features delicate, lavender-blue blooms and prefers well-drained soil.
  • Knautia integrifolia: This cultivar boasts deep, velvety-red flowers and a more compact growth habit, making it well-suited for smaller garden spaces.

Site Selection and Soil Preparation

Knautia plants prefer full sun exposure, with at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day. They can tolerate partial shade, but their flowers may not be as vibrant and abundant. When it comes to soil, Knautia thrives in well-drained, slightly alkaline conditions. Amend your soil with compost or other organic matter to improve drainage and fertility before planting.

Planting and Spacing

The best time to plant Knautia in the US is in the spring or fall, when temperatures are mild and the soil is moist but not waterlogged. Space your plants 12 to 18 inches apart to allow for proper air circulation and growth. Gently loosen the roots of your Knautia plants before placing them in the ground, and water thoroughly after planting.

Ongoing Care and Maintenance

Once your Knautia plants are established, they require minimal maintenance. Keep the soil consistently moist, but be careful not to overwater, as Knautia is susceptible to root rot in overly wet conditions. Deadhead spent flowers to encourage more blooms throughout the growing season, and consider adding a layer of mulch around the base of the plants to help retain moisture and suppress weeds.

Indoor Cultivation: Growing Knautia in Containers

If you don’t have a garden or are looking to bring the beauty of Knautia indoors, you can successfully grow these plants in containers on your balcony, patio, or even inside your home. Here’s how to get started:

Choosing the Right Container

Knautia plants have a relatively shallow root system, so they can thrive in a wide variety of container sizes and materials. Look for a pot that is at least 12 inches wide and 8 inches deep, with ample drainage holes to prevent waterlogging. Terracotta, plastic, or even wooden planters can all work well.

Soil and Potting Mix

When growing Knautia in containers, it’s essential to use a well-draining potting mix specifically formulated for containers and raised beds. Avoid using regular garden soil, as it can become compacted and lead to poor drainage. You can also amend your potting mix with compost or perlite to improve aeration and nutrient content.

Planting and Placement

Plant your Knautia in the container at the same depth as it was growing in its original container or nursery pot. Space multiple plants 12 to 18 inches apart, depending on the size of your container. Place your potted Knautia in a location that receives at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day, such as a balcony, patio, or sunny windowsill.

Watering and Feeding

Knautia grown in containers will require more frequent watering than their in-ground counterparts, as the potting mix can dry out more quickly. Check the soil regularly and water when the top inch or two becomes dry. Be careful not to overwater, as this can lead to root rot. Additionally, feed your container-grown Knautia with a balanced, water-soluble fertilizer every 2-3 weeks during the growing season to ensure they receive the necessary nutrients.

Overwintering and Maintenance

In many parts of the US, Knautia is considered a hardy perennial that can survive the winter months. However, if you’re growing your Knautia in a container, you’ll need to take some additional steps to ensure its survival. In late fall, gradually reduce watering and stop fertilizing to allow the plant to go dormant. When temperatures start to drop, move your container to a protected area, such as a garage or shed, where it can receive some sunlight and maintain a consistent, cool temperature (around 40-50°F).

In early spring, as the weather starts to warm up, gradually reintroduce your Knautia to the outdoors and resume regular watering and feeding. You may need to prune any dead or damaged foliage to encourage new growth and blooms.

Troubleshooting and Common Issues

While Knautia is generally a low-maintenance and resilient plant, there are a few common issues you may encounter when growing it in the US:

  • Pests: Aphids, spider mites, and thrips can all be problematic for Knautia plants. Use organic pest control methods, such as insecticidal soap or neem oil, to keep these pests at bay.
  • Diseases: Knautia can be susceptible to powdery mildew, rust, and root rot, especially in humid or wet conditions. Ensure proper air circulation, avoid overwatering, and consider using a fungicide if necessary.
  • Deadheading: Regular deadheading of spent flowers is essential to encourage continued blooming throughout the growing season. Be sure to remove the entire flower stem down to the next set of leaves or leaf nodes.
  • Winterkill: In colder regions of the US, Knautia may not be fully hardy and may require additional protection, such as a layer of mulch or a cold frame, to survive the winter months.
